However, despite their numerous advantages, military drones also pose several challenges and ethical concerns. One of the main issues is the potential for drones to be used for targeted killings and civilian casualties in conflict zones. The use of drones in targeted strikes raises questions about the legality and morality of such operations, prompting calls for greater transparency and accountability in drone warfare.

Title: “Revolutionizing Warfare: The Evolution of Military Drones” In recent years, military drones have emerged as a game-changer in modern warfare, reshaping the dynamics of conflicts across the globe. From surveillance and reconnaissance missions to targeted strikes and combat operations, these unmanned aerial vehicles (UAVs) have revolutionized the way military operations are conducted. The evolution of military drones has not only enhanced the capabilities of armed forces but has also raised ethical and legal questions regarding their use in warfare. Initially developed for intelligence gathering and reconnaissance purposes, military drones have evolved to become a critical tool in the arsenal of modern military forces. Equipped with advanced sensors, high-resolution cameras, and real-time communication systems, drones provide militaries with unprecedented situational awareness and the ability to conduct precision strikes with minimal collateral damage. This capability has been particularly evident in the targeted elimination of high-value targets in remote and hostile environments, where traditional aircraft and ground forces would face significant risks. Moreover, the proliferation of military drones has opened up new possibilities for asymmetric warfare, empowering non-state actors and insurgent groups to wage unconventional conflicts against conventional military forces. The use of drones by terrorist organizations for surveillance, reconnaissance, and even targeted attacks has posed significant challenges to national security and raised concerns about the potential misuse of this technology by malicious actors. However, despite their strategic advantages, military drones have also sparked controversies and debates surrounding their ethical implications and compliance with international law. The use of drones in targeted killings and extrajudicial executions has raised questions about accountability, transparency, and the protection of civilian lives in conflict zones. The lack of clear regulations and oversight mechanisms governing the use of drones has fueled concerns about their potential for misuse and abuse in the hands of state and non-state actors. In conclusion, the evolution of military drones represents a paradigm shift in the way wars are fought and conflicts are resolved in the 21st century. While these unmanned aerial vehicles offer unprecedented advantages in terms of intelligence, surveillance, and precision strikes, their use raises complex moral, legal, and strategic challenges that must be carefully addressed. As military drones continue to proliferate and diversify, policymakers, military leaders, and civil society must engage in a critical dialogue to ensure the responsible and ethical use of this transformative technology in the pursuit of global peace and security.
